Tibu goa


About this place

Discover the enchanting Tibu Goa, a historical landmark nestled in the serene landscapes of Bulian, Kubutambahan, within the Buleleng Regency of North Bali. This captivating site offers a unique blend of natural wonder and profound cultural heritage, inviting visitors to step back in time and connect with Bali's ancient past. Located away from the bustling southern areas, Tibu Goa provides a tranquil escape, promising an authentic experience amidst North Bali's unspoiled beauty.

The name Tibu Goa, which translates roughly to 'cave with water' or 'spring cave,' reveals an intriguing geological formation believed to hold significant spiritual importance to the local community. Visitors can explore its cool, mysterious depths, marveling at the natural rock formations and the gentle sounds of trickling water. The area surrounding the cave is equally picturesque, making it an ideal spot for quiet contemplation and appreciating the natural splendor of Bali. A visit to Tibu Goa offers a profound sense of peace and a deeper understanding of the island's natural and spiritual tapestry.


Travel Route

Arrival at Tibu Goa: Plan to arrive in the late morning or early afternoon to enjoy ample daylight for exploration. Tibu Goa is best reached by private vehicle or scooter from nearby towns like Singaraja or Lovina, offering scenic drives through the Buleleng countryside.

Exploration of the Cave: Upon arrival, take your time to descend towards the cave entrance. Explore the cool, ancient depths of Tibu Goa, appreciating its natural rock formations and the serene atmosphere. It is recommended to bring a small flashlight or use your phone's light for better visibility inside the cave.

Enjoying the Surroundings: After exploring the cave, spend some time enjoying the tranquil natural environment outside. This is a perfect spot for quiet contemplation, photography, and simply soaking in the peaceful ambiance away from the crowds.

Departure: Conclude your visit in the late afternoon. Consider combining your trip with a visit to other attractions in North Bali, such as nearby waterfalls or traditional villages, before heading back to your accommodation, enriching your overall North Bali experience.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the historical significance of Tibu Goa? expand_more

Tibu Goa is revered as a historical landmark and a site of significant spiritual importance for the local community in North Bali. It is believed to have been a place of worship or meditation for ancient Balinese people, with its natural cave structure and water source contributing to its sacred aura.

What kind of experience can I expect when visiting Tibu Goa? expand_more

Visitors can expect a serene and introspective experience. You can explore the natural cave system, observe unique rock formations, and listen to the tranquil sounds of nature. The surrounding area offers picturesque views, ideal for quiet reflection and photography away from typical tourist crowds.

Are there any entrance fees or specific operating hours for Tibu Goa? expand_more

As of current information, Tibu Goa is generally open to the public without a formal entrance fee, though donations for local maintenance are often appreciated. It is advisable to visit during daylight hours for safety and better visibility, especially when exploring inside the cave.

How accessible is Tibu Goa? expand_more

Tibu Goa is located in a rural part of Buleleng, and access typically involves navigating local roads. While the path to the cave entrance is generally manageable, some sections might be uneven or damp. Comfortable walking shoes are highly recommended, and it may not be ideal for those with severe mobility issues.

Is Tibu Goa suitable for all ages? expand_more

While generally accessible, visitors should be aware that the cave environment can be dim and surfaces might be uneven or damp. Young children should be closely supervised, and individuals with mobility challenges might find certain sections difficult to navigate safely.
